Foal
by
Linda Lee Konichek


Next
 

 

The wonder of it all?
almost a year of waiting
a week of sleepless nights

Finally    this
the mare presents
one    tiny   perfect   hoof

encased in an iridescent bubble
as magical as those we blew
through childhood’s wands

We wait   breathless
for one more miniature hoof
Next the milky sphere
reveals 

a baby nose,
nostrils already flaring
trying to breathe.

Like an axed tree
    the mare
      drops

In one convulsive heave
the bubble bursts expelling 
a flawless foal

Its little whinny is answered
by a low encouraging
nicker of love

We are awed to silence. . .
miracles take place in a stable

From Celebrating the Heart-land (Jericho Productions, 2009).
Used with the author’s permission.

 

 

 


 

Linda Lee (Konichek) is a textbook author, entrepreneur, and former teacher who has always loved poetry, horses, and Wisconsin--not necessarily in that order. For the past twenty-five years, she has raised Morab horses (a cross between Morgans and Arabians) on a 114-acre farm in Eagle, Wisconsin; her poems tend to reflect the every day miracles that surround her there.
